Hong Kong's legendary hotels, like the Mandarin Oriental (since 1963) and the Peninsula, celebrating this year its 85 years, are not playing alone, anymore in this vibrant city...

At the moment, every body seems to be overshadowed by the highest hotel in the world, the Ritz Carlton rising up to 490 meters !

It is THE hotel to be at the moment. Imagine a lobby on the 103d floor, the highest bar in the world, the highest swimming pool in the world and keep on going....

An other impressing cool hotel, should be "The Icon", opening at a lobby with 8.000 plants.........

So, the "great old ladies", are facing serious challenges....
